Definitions:

Elastic

Describes a situation in which the quantity demanded or supplied of a good or service changes significantly in response to a change in price.

Total Revenues

The total amount of income generated by the sale of goods or services related to a company's primary operations.

Elastic Demand

Elastic demand refers to a situation where the quantity demanded of a product changes significantly in response to changes in its price.

Consultant

A professional who provides expert advice in a particular area or industry.
